Defensive Scheme Vulnerability (TE/Slot)

Pinpointing mismatches against TEs and slot receivers.

3.2x Target Rate Increase in Top Mismatches

Overview

This pillar analyzes NFL defensive schemes to identify specific vulnerabilities against tight ends and slot receivers. It moves beyond generic team rankings to find exploitable matchups for player proposition markets.

What It Does

It deconstructs a defense's tendencies, focusing on how frequently they use schemes like Cover 2 or Cover 3 that create soft spots in the middle of the field. The pillar then cross-references this with the opposing offense's personnel, identifying when an elite TE or slot WR is poised to exploit a linebacker or safety in coverage. This produces a vulnerability score for specific player props.

Why It Matters

General defensive stats can be misleading. This analysis provides a predictive edge by highlighting specific, recurring schematic flaws that lead to high-volume passing games for interior receivers. It helps you position on the matchup, not just the team's reputation.

How It Works

First, the pillar aggregates defensive formation and coverage scheme data from the last four games for a given team. Second, it analyzes opposing TE and slot WR performance against those specific schemes, measuring stats like target rate and yards per route run. Finally, it generates a mismatch score by comparing the defense's vulnerability to the specific strengths of the upcoming opponent's players.

Methodology

Analysis is based on a rolling 4-game window to weigh recent performance. It calculates a Mismatch Score using a weighted average of: DVOA vs. TE/Slot WRs (40%), PFF Coverage Grades for relevant LBs and Safeties (30%), and Yards Per Route Run allowed to the specific position (30%). A team's high usage rate of a vulnerable scheme (e.g., Cover 2 vs. a seam-stretching TE) significantly boosts the score.

Key Indicators

  • DVOA vs. TE

    high

    Defense-adjusted Value Over Average against opposing tight ends, indicating overall efficiency.

  • Slot Coverage Grade

    high

    Performance grade for primary slot defenders, identifying weak links in the secondary.

  • LB/Safety Mismatch Pct.

    medium

    Percentage of pass plays where a TE or slot WR is covered by a linebacker or safety with a poor coverage grade.
